Cardano is a leading Cryptocurrency project launched in September 2017 by Charles Hoskinson and Jeremy Wood, who both played pivotal roles in the establishment of Ethereum. Cardano was created with the intention to improve upon existing c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um aiming to achieve greater scalability, interoperability, and sustainability at a level not yet reached in the industry. It does so using a unique proof of stake algorithm called Ouroboros. The native currency used on the Cardano blockchain is called Ada, which is stored in its own unique wallet, known as the Daedalus wallet.
This wallet allows users to stake their Ada and achieve passive income. Ada has a maximum supply of $45 billion with only a portion of which in circulation with nor more than 0.3% of the reserve ADA will be released every 5 days.
